- Born July 13, 1913
Handley played baseball for Soldan High School and the Jerome Goldman Post American Legion team in St. Louis, Missouri. The Goldman team won the Missouri championship "due to a large degree to Handley\'s hitting and fielding."\n', '
Handley played quarterback for Bradley Polytechnic Institute, with his accomplishments including a 50-yard pass that won a game in 1934. An article in the May 25, 1937, issue of the Pittsburgh Post-Gazette described him as the "leading quarterback of the conference, featured schedule with his passing running and kicking." \n', '
In 1933, Handley won the Most Valuable Player Award in football in the Interstate Intercollegiate Athletic Conference, and he was an all-conference second baseman two years. He also was a guard and captain on the basketball team and ran track at Bradley.\n', '
